AXON Master Services and Purchasing Agreement This Master Services and Purchasing Agreement (the Agreement) by and between Axon Enterprise, Inc., (Axon or Party) a Delaware corporation having its principal place of business at 17800 N 85th Street, Scottsdale, Arizona, 85255, and City of Tybee Island (Agency, Party or collectively Parties), is entered into the later of (a) the last signature date on this Agreement, or (b) the signature date on the quote (the Effective Date). This Agreement sets forth the terms and conditions for the purchase, delivery, use, and support of Axon products and services as detailed in the Quote Appendix (the Quote), which is hereby incorporated by reference. It is the intent of the Parties that this Agreement shall act as a master agreement governing all subsequent purchases by Agency of Axon Products and all subsequent quotes for the same Products or Services accepted by Agency shall be also incorporated by reference as a Quote. In consideration of this Agreement, the Parties agree as follows: 1 Term. This Agreement will commence on the Effective Date and will remain in full force and effect until terminated by either Party. The initial term of this Agreement will be for one (1) year, and will automatically renew annually thereafter, for a total period of five (5) years, subject to the provisions herein. Axon services will not be authorized until a signed Quote or Purchase Order is accepted by Axon, whichever is first. 2 Definitions. Invoices are due to be paid within 30 days of the date of invoice, unless otherwise specified by Axon. All orders are subject to prior credit approval. Payment obligations are non- cancelable and fees paid are non-refundable and all amounts payable will be made without setoff, deduction, or withholding. If a delinquent account is sent to collections, the Agency is responsible for all collection and attorneys' fees. In the event the Agency chooses a phased deployment for the Products in the Quote, the Quote pricing is subject to change if the phased deployment changes. 4 Taxes. Unless Axon is provided with a valid and correct tax exemption certificate applicable to the purchase and ship -to location, the Agency is responsible for sales and other taxes associated with the order. 5 Shipping: Title: Risk of Loss: Reiection. Axon reserves the right to make partial shipments and Products may ship from multiple locations. All shipments are FOB Destination and title and risk of loss pass to the Agency upon delivery to the Agency. The Agency is responsible for all freight charges. Shipping dates are estimates only. The Agency may reject Products that do not match the Products listed in the Quote or are damaged or non-functional upon receipt (Nonconforming Product) by providing Axon written notice of rejection within 10 days of shipment. In the event the Agency receives a Nonconforming Product, the Agency's sole remedy is to return the Product to Axon for repair or replacement as further described in Section 7 - Warranties. Failure to notify Axon within the 10 -day rejection period will be deemed as acceptance of Product. 6 Returns. All sales are final and no refunds or exchanges are allowed, except for warranty returns or as provided by state or federal law. 7 Warranties. 7.1 Hardware Limited Warranty. Axon warrants that its law enforcement hardware products are free from defects in workmanship and materials for a period of ONE (1) YEAR from the date of receipt. Extended warranties run from the date of purchase of the extended warranty through the balance of the 1 -year limited warranty term plus the term of the extended warranty measured after the expiration of the 1 -year limited warranty. CEW cartridges and Smart cartridges that are expended are deemed to have operated properly. Axon - Manufactured Accessories are covered under a limited 90 -DAY warranty from the date of receipt. Non -Axon manufactured accessories are covered under the manufacturer's warranty. If Axon determines that a valid warranty claim is received within the warranty period, as further described in the Warranty Limitations section, Axon agrees to repair or replace the Product. Axon's sole responsibility under this warranty is to either repair or replace with the same or like Product, at Axon's option. 7.2 Warranty Limitations. Approved to form: ____7....4 Title: Master Services and Purchasing Agreement between Axon and Agency Department: Sales/Customer Service Version: 1.0 Release Date: 6116/2017 Page 8 of 22 Evidence.com Terms of Use Appendix 1 Evidence.com Subscription Term. The Evidence.com Subscription will begin after shipment of the Axon body worn cameras. If shipped in 1st half of the month, the start date is on the 1st of the following month. If shipped in the last half of the month, the start date is on the 15th of the following month. For phased deployments, the Evidence.com Subscription begins upon the shipment of the first phase. For purchases that consist solely of Evidence.com licenses, the Subscription will begin upon the Effective Date. 2 Access Rights. "Agency Content" means software, data, text, audio, video, images or other Agency content or any of the Agency's end users (a) run on the Evidence.com Services, (b) cause to interface with the Evidence.com Services, or (c) upload to the Evidence.com Services under the Agency account or otherwise transfer, process, use or store in connection with the Agency account. Upon the purchase or granting of a subscription from Axon and the opening of an Evidence.com account, the Agency will have access and use of the Evidence.com Services for the storage and management of Agency Content during the subscription term (Term). The Evidence.com Service and data storage are subject to usage limits. The Evidence.com Service may not be accessed by more than the number of end users specified in the Quote. If Agency becomes aware of any violation of this Agreement by an end user, the Agency will immediately terminate that end user's access to Agency Content and the Evidence.com Services. For Evidence.com Lite licenses, the Agency will have access and use of Evidence.com Lite for only the storage and management of data from TASER CEWs and the TASER CAM during the subscription Term. The Evidence.com Lite Service may not be accessed to upload any non-TASER CAM video or any other files. 3 Agency Owns Agency Content. The Agency controls and owns all right, title, and interest in and to Agency Content and except as otherwise outlined herein, Axon obtains no interest in the Agency Content, and the Agency Content are not business records of Axon. The Agency is solely responsible for the uploading, sharing, withdrawal, management and deletion of Agency Content. Axon will have limited access to Agency Content solely for providing and supporting the Evidence.com Services to the Agency and Agency end users. The Agency represents that the Agency owns Agency Content; and that none of Agency Content or Agency end users' use of Agency Content or the Evidence.com Services will violate this Agreement or applicable laws. 4 Evidence.com Data Security . 4.1. Generally. Axon will implement commercially reasonable and appropriate measures designed to secure Agency Content against accidental or unlawful loss, access or disclosure. Axon will maintain a comprehensive Information Security Program (ISP) that includes logical and physical access management, vulnerability management, configuration management, incident monitoring and response, encryption of digital evidence uploaded, security education, risk management, and data protection. The Agency is responsible for maintaining the security of end user names and passwords and taking steps to maintain appropriate security and access by end users to Agency Title: Master Services and Purchasing Agreement between Axon and Agency Department: Sales/Customer Service Version: 1.0 Release Date: 6/16/2017 Page 9 of 22 Content. Login credentials are for Agency internal use only and Agency may not sell, transfer, or sublicense them to any other entity or person. The Agency agrees to be responsible for all activities undertaken by the Agency, Agency employees, Agency contractors or agents, and Agency end users that result in unauthorized access to the Agency account or Agency Content. Audit log tracking for the video data is an automatic feature of the Services that provides details as to who accesses the video data and may be downloaded by the Agency at any time. The Agency shall contact Axon immediately if an unauthorized third party may be using the Agency account or Agency Content or if account information is lost or stolen. 4.2. FBI CJIS Security Addendum. Axon agrees to the terms and requirements set forth in the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) Criminal Justice Information Services (CJIS) Security Addendum for the Term of this Agreement. 5 Axon's Support. Axon will make available updates as released by Axon to the Evidence.com Services. Updates may be provided electronically via the Internet. Axon will use reasonable efforts to continue supporting the previous version of any software for 6 months after the change (except if doing so (a) would pose a security or intellectual property issue, (b) is economically or technically burdensome, or (c) is needed to comply with the law or requests of governmental entities. The Agency is responsible for maintaining the computer equipment and Internet connections necessary for use of the Evidence.com Services. 6 Data Privacy. Axon will not disclose Agency Content or any information about the Agency except as compelled by a court or administrative body or required by any law or regulation. Axon will give notice if any disclosure request is received for Agency Content so the Agency may file an objection with the court or administrative body. The Agency agrees to allow Axon access to certain information from the Agency in order to: (a) perform troubleshooting services upon request or as part of Axon's regular diagnostic screenings; (b) enforce this agreement or policies governing use of Evidence.com Services; or (c) perform analytic and diagnostic evaluations of the systems. 7 Data Storage. Axon will determine the locations of the data centers in which Agency Content will be stored and accessible by Agency end users. For United States customers, Axon will ensure that all Agency Content stored in the Evidence.com Services remains within the United States, including any backup data, replication sites, and disaster recovery sites. Axon may transfer Agency Content to third parties for the purpose of storage of Agency Content. Third party subcontractors responsible for storage of Agency Content are contracted by Axon for data storage services. Ownership of Agency Content remains with the Agency. For use of an Unlimited Evidence.com License, unlimited data may be stored in the Agency's Evidence.com account only if the data originates from an Axon Body Worn Camera or Axon Capture device. Axon reserves the right to charge additional fees for exceeding purchased storage amounts or for Axon's assistance in the downloading or exporting of Agency Content. Axon may place into archival storage any data stored in the Agency's Evidence.com accounts that has not been viewed or accessed for 6 months. Data stored in archival storage will not have immediate availability, and may take up to 24 hours to access. 8 Suspension of Evidence.com Services. Title: Master Services and Purchasing Agreement between Anon and Agency Department: Sales/Customer Service Version: 1.0 Releau Date: 6/1612017 Page 15 of 22 TASER Assurance Plan Appendix The TASER Assurance Plan ("TAP") is an optional plan the Agency may purchase. If TAP is included on the Quote, this TAP Appendix applies. TAP may be purchased as a standalone plan. TAP for Axon body worn cameras is also included as part of Ultimate and Unlimited Licenses, as well as under the Officer Safety Plan. TAP provides hardware extended warranty coverage, Spare Products, and Upgrade Models at the end of the TAP Term. TAP only applies to the Axon Product listed in the Quote with the exception of any initial hardware or any software services offered for, by, or through the Evidence.com website. The Agency may not buy more than one TAP for any one covered Product. 1 TAP Warranty Coverage. TAP includes the extended warranty coverage described in the current hardware warranty. TAP warranty coverage starts at the end of the Hardware Limited Warranty term and continues as long as the Agency continues to pay the required annual fees for TAP. The Agency may not have both an optional extended warranty and TAP on the Axon camera/Dock product. TAP for the Axon camera products also includes free replacement of the Axon flex controller battery and Axon body battery during the TAP Term for any failure that is not specifically excluded from the Hardware Warranty. 2 TAP Term. TAP Term start date is based upon the shipment date of the hardware covered under TAP. If the shipment of the hardware occurred in the first half of the month, then the Term starts on the 1st of the following month. If the shipment of the hardware occurred in the second half of the month, then the Term starts on the 15th of the following month. 3 SPARE Product. Axon will provide a predetermined number of spare Products for those hardware items and accessories listed in the Quote (collectively the "Spare Products") to keep at the Agency location to replace broken or non-functioning units in order to improve the availability of the units to officers in the field. The Agency must return to Axon, through Axon's Return Merchandise Authorization (RMA) process, any broken or non-functioning units for which a Spare Product is utilized, and Axon will repair the non-functioning unit or replace with a replacement product. Axon warrants it will repair or replace the unit that fails to function for any reason not excluded by the TAP warranty coverage, during the TAP Term with the same product or a like product, at Axon's sole option. The Agency may not buy a new TAP for the replacement product or the Spare Product. 3.1. Within 30 days of the end of the TAP Term, the Agency must return to Axon all Spare Products. The Agency will be invoiced for and is obligated to pay to Axon the MSRP then in effect for all Spare Products not returned to Axon. If all the Spare Products are returned to Axon, then Axon will refresh the allotted number of Spare Products with Upgrade Models if the Agency purchases a new TAP for the Upgrade Models. 4 TAP Officer Safety Plan (OSP). If the Officer Safety Plan (OSP) is included on the Quote, this section applies. OSP includes the benefits of the Evidence.com Unlimited License (which includes unlimited data storage for Axon camera and Axon Capture generated data in the Evidence.com Services and TAP for the Axon Camera), TAP for Evidence.com Dock, one Axon brand CEW with a 4 -year Warranty, one CEW battery, and one CEW holster. At any time during Tltle: IAaver Sar.lcM mul Purchasing Agreement between Azon end Agency fleperarmnt SagesiCAlst.to SerWw Version: 1.0 Release Date: 6,16r2017 Page 16 of 22 the OSP term, the Agency may choose to receive the CEW, battery and holster by providing a $0 purchase order. At the time elected to receive the CEW, the Agency may choose from any current CEW model offered. The OSP plan must be purchased for a period of 5 years. If the OSP is terminated before the end of the term and the Agency did not receive a CEW, battery or holster, then we will have no obligation to reimburse for those items not received. If OSP is terminated before the end of the term and the Agency received a CEW, battery and/or holster then (a) the Agency will be invoiced for the remainder of the MSRP for the Products received and not already paid as part of the OSP before the termination date; or (b) only in the case of termination for non -appropriations, return the CEW, battery and holster to Axon within 30 days of the date of termination. 5 TAP Upgrade Models. Any products replaced within the 6 months prior to the scheduled upgrade will be deemed the Upgrade Model. Thirty days after the Upgrade Models are received, the Agency must return the products to Axon or Axon will deactivate the serial numbers for the products received by the Agency. In the case of Axon cameras, the Agency may keep the original products only if the Agency purchases additional Evidence.com licenses for the Axon camera products the Agency is keeping. The Agency may buy a new TAP for any Upgraded Model. Upgrade Models are to be provided as follows during and/or after the TAP Term: (i) an upgrade will provided in year 3 if the Agency purchased 3 years of Evidence.com services with Ultimate Licenses or Unlimited Licenses, or TAP as a stand-alone service, and all payments are made; or (ii) 2.5 years after the TAP Term begins and once again 5 years after the TAP Term begins if the Agency purchased 5 years of Evidence.com services with an Ultimate License or Unlimited Licenses, OSP, or TAP as a stand-alone service, and made all TAP payments. The project scope will consist of the development of an integration module that allows the Evidence.com Service to interact with the Agency's Computer -Aided Dispatch (CAD) or Records Management Systems (RMS), so that Agency's licensees may use the integration module to automatically tag the Axon recorded videos with a case ID, category, and location. The integration module will allow the Integration Module License holders to auto populate the Axon video meta -data saved to the Evidence.com Service based on data already maintained in the Agency's CAD or RMS. Axon is responsible to perform only the Integration Services described in this Appendix and any additional services discussed or implied that are not defined explicitly by this Appendix will be considered outside the scope of this Agreement and may result in additional fees. 3 Pricing. All Integration Services performed by Axon will be rendered in accordance with the fees and payment terms set forth in the Quote. The Agency must purchase Axon Integration licenses for every Evidence.com user in the Agency, even if the user does not have an Axon body camera. 4 Delivery of Integration Services. 4.1.
